Overview
Microsoft Advertising is standing up the Tools / TrueCRM Group Product Lead function as the single-threaded business owner for TrueCRM and adjacent seller tooling. This function connects field-validated seller and sales-manager pain points to prioritized product investments, landing plans, adoption, and measurable business outcomes across Microsoft Advertising.
We are looking for a Principal Business Program Manager to serve as a senior Tools / TrueCRM GPL individual contributor. This role will own one or more high-priority CRM and seller-tooling domains end to end, translating complex field workflows into clear problem statements, business requirements, roadmap priorities, launch plans, and success measures. The right candidate is equally comfortable with sellers and sales leaders, Product and Engineering teams, data and telemetry, and executive stakeholders.
This is not a generic operations role. The role requires deep CRM and seller-workflow judgment, solid product and data fluency, and the ability to lead without authority across a fast-moving, cross-functional environment.

Business Program Management IC6 - The typical base pay range for this role across the U.S. is USD $130,900 - $277,200 per year. There is a different range applicable to specific work locations, within the San Francisco Bay area and New York City metropolitan area, and the base pay range for this role in those locations is USD $165,600 - $303,600 per year.
